IEEE Transactions on Microwave Theory and Techniques | 1990
Jibendu Sekhar Roy; D. R. Poddar; Amitava Mukherjee; Santosh Kumar Chowdhury
An empirical expression for the effective dielectric permittivity of curved microstrip transmission lines is derived. This expression is very general because it can also be used for rectangular microstrip lines by considering a rectangular line as a curved line of infinite radius of curvature. The closed-form expression for the frequency dependence of the effective dielectric permittivity of a rectangular microstrip line is compared with other available results. This expression for the frequency dependence of the effective dielectric permittivity of curved microstrip transmission lines is simple, accurate, and suitable for CAD implementation. The measured and computed results for various curved microstrip lines are compared, and excellent agreement between the two is obtained. >
Iete Journal of Research | 1996
P. Paul; Jibendu Sekhar Roy; S. K. Chowdhury
Previous experimental investigations revealed that by properly locating the feed along one of the radiating edges of rectangular microstrip antenna, 1:2 VSWR bandwidth can be improved considerably at TM11 mode. In this paper, keeping the location of the feed at a suitable point the effect of the variation of aspect ratio of the patch has been investigated. Further improvement in 1: 2 VSWR bandwidth with the change of aspect ratio has been observed and the measured data has been presented. These experimental results have been verified by FDTD method. Measured radiation patterns have also been presented alongwith theoretical computation by cavity model.
